EHRMAN v. COOK ELEC. CO.

No. 79-2373.

630 F.2d 529 (1980)

Fred EHRMAN, Plaintiff-Appellant, v. COOK ELECTRIC COMPANY and Northern Telecom Limited, Defendants-Appellees.

United States Court of Appeals, Seventh Circuit.

Decided September 17, 1980.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

George W. Hamman, Chicago, Ill., for plaintiff-appellant.

Stewart S. Dixon, Chicago, Ill., for defendants-appellees.

Before CUMMINGS, Circuit Judge, NICHOLS, Associate Judge, and PELL, Circuit Judge.


PER CURIAM.

The plaintiff, Fred Ehrman, appeals from the judgment entered by the district court after granting the defendants' motion for a directed verdict under Fed.R.Civ.P. 50(a).

The plaintiff argues, and we agree, that Illinois law applies to this case.1 To recover a finder's fee under Illinois law, the plaintiff must demonstrate the existence of an agreement, express or implied, to pay for services in finding an acquisition...
